Rescuers are pumping water from residential buildings and households in Uzhgorod and Svalyava.
In the Transcarpathian region, heavy rains caused local rivers to rise. Roads, homes and agricultural land were flooded in all areas of the region, the State Emergency Service reported on Saturday, December 2.
It is indicated that 440 hectares of agricultural land were flooded in Beregovo and Khust districts.
Rescuers pumped water from buildings and homes in the cities of Uzhgorod and Svalyava, as well as in the villages of Krichevo and Lazy in the Tyachevsky district and in the village of Bogdan in the Rakhivsky district.
“Two local roads between the settlements of the village of Chernotysovo and the village of Kholmovets, and between the village of V. Komyati and the village of Shalanki, Beregovsky district, are flooded. Travel is possible. The H-09 highway Mukachevo-Rogatyn -Lvov between the settlements of the city is also flooded. Tyachev and the village of Bedevlya, travel is possible, “said the message.
It was also found that the supporting wall of a private household in the village of Roztoki was displaced as a result of waterlogging.
It was previously known that a storm warning was announced in western Ukraine. Almost 500 settlements were cut off due to bad weather.
